Located in the heart of Marylebone Village, this architecturally reimagined one-bedroom top-floor flat has been redesigned to balance minimalist style with intelligent use of space.

Step out your front door into the village atmosphere of Marylebone Lane and Marylebone High Street, surrounded by independent cafés, boutiques and restaurants, and within moments of the iconic Selfridges and Oxford Street.

The home has been cleverly transformed by architectural studio SoHoKo, whose considered interventions maximise natural light and make every inch of the layout count.

Thoughtful design defines the interiors, with refined details that make the space both stylish and efficient. A glazed internal panel subtly separates the living area and bedroom, allowing soft southern light to filter through the apartment. Pocket doors have also been used throughout to create more space.

The kitchen has been extended in depth to provide generous work surfaces while maintaining a clean, contemporary aesthetic. The bedroom enjoys a quiet, southerly aspect and features a cleverly designed walk-in double shower, complemented by a separate guest cloakroom off the hallway.

Clean lines and premium finishes, including engineered oak and bespoke Corian, define each space with thoughtful detailing and quiet sophistication. Every element has been carefully considered to enhance the flow, light and liveability of the home.
